Abstract: |
The computer-aided nonlinear fitting for the curing curves of NR compounds in sulfur vulcanization and semi-efficient vulcanization at different temperatures was made by using the model for kinetics of vulcanization reversion based on the reversion mechanism of sulfur cured NR vulcanizate to obtain the velocity constants in various reaction steps,the sum of single sulfide bonds,double sulfide bonds and polysulfide bonds,and the crosslinking density as a function of the curing time.The results showed that the simulated curves of two curing systems at different temperatures were fitted to the measured data,and the obtained relationship between the velocity constant and the curing temperature of the same system was in accordance with the Arrhenius equation.The reversion increased as the temperature rose,which could be explained by the fact that the activating energies of the polysulfide bond cracking for both systems were greater than those of the devulcanization. |
